Christ University, beginning as Christ College in 1966, has grown to support various affiliated colleges and schools under it. Further, the university also has set up two separate campus locations at Bannerghatta and Kengari. Below-mentioned are the prominent schools under Christ University:

Christ University Bangalore Schools of Study

School of Architecture

School of Arts and HumanitiesSchool of Business and Management
School of Commerce, Finance and AccountancySchool of EducationSchool of Engineering and Technology
School of LawSchool of SciencesSchool of Social Sciences

Christ University is a popular university & its admissions process is based on the scoring received by students in the precribed entrance examinations. The university accepts examinations like MAT, XAT, CMAT, Karnataka PGCET, ATMA, etc., for MBA courses. For admissions into BTech, students can appear for the KCET examination. Students can visit the site & learn futher about the course-wise eligibility requirements. Christ University also holds its own in-house entrance test known as Christ University Entrance Test (CUET).
